Mom Central recently asked us to try the new Infantino Ecosash Baby Carrier. I am a huge fan of the Ergo Baby Carrier, so was thrilled to receive this carrier!
The carrier has a great reversible design, and is similar to the popular mei tei style carriers. It fits babies from 8 – 35 pounds. You can use it face-in, face-out, or as a backpack. It features a supportive headrest that can fold down or up. Here are my thoughts on this carrier: It can take awhile to become comfortable tying this carrier and getting it to fit snugly enough, but once you get the hang of it, it doesn’t take long. The first few times you use it, have a friend nearby to help you tie it properly! I wish that it came in colors other than black, because black is WAY too hot to use outside in Kansas summers! But I love that it comes with a mesh bag to use when washing in the laundry! The detachable hood is great, and you can use it to cover up baby when you’re outside. Overall, I prefer the Ergo Baby Carrier for ease of use, but with the price of this carrier around only $50, this one is a great second choice!
